Chapter 6 Summary

About a week later, Ray and Japhy go on a planed hiking trip. Ray is a neophyte hiker, but Japhy is experienced and plans most of the trip. Japhy supplies nearly all of the equipment for the trip, including shoes, sleeping bags and food. Japhy is friendly and mildly patronizing to Ray's nearly complete lack of basic hiking knowledge and spends some time telling Ray about mountain climbing facts. Ray expresses concern that the amount of food Japhy has packed will be vastly insufficient, but Japhy ignores Ray's concerns. Ray also wants to take a supply of wine, but Japhy dismisses the idea.
